#0E491B Color
#0E491B is rgb(14, 73, 27) in RGB, hsl(133, 68%, 17%) in HSL, and about cmyk(81%, 0%, 63%, 71%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Forest Green (Traditional) (#014421),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.44.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#0E491B Channel Values
How #0E491B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 14 · G 73 · B 27 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 133° · S 68% · L 17%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 133° · S 81% · V 29%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 81% · M 0% · Y 63% · K 71%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.57:1 vs white · 1.99: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#0E491B background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#0E491B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#0E491B?
#0E491B is a darkest green — rgb(14, 73, 27) in RGB and hsl(133, 68%, 17%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Forest Green (Traditional) (#014421),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.44.
What is the RGB value of #0E491B?
#0E491B is rgb(14, 73, 27) — red 14, green 73, and blue 27 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#0E491B?
#0E491B converts to approximately cmyk(81%, 0%, 63%, 71%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#0E491B be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#0E491B scores 10.57:1 against white and 1.99: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#0E491B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#0E491B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kolivegreen (#556B2F) at a CIE76 distance of 21.31, which is visibly different.
